How much do nbc internships j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for nbc internships in the United States is $21.34,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.07 and $24.76 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an NBC internship?

An NBC Internship is a temporary position designed for students or recent graduates to gain hands-on experience in the media industry. Interns work in various departments such as news, production, marketing, and digital media. These programs provide mentorship, networking opportunities, and practical training to help interns develop essential skills. Most internships are offered seasonally and may be paid or unpaid, depending on the role and location.

What do NBC interns do?

NBC Interns are often involved in a variety of projects, including supporting production teams, conducting industry research, helping with script preparation, editing digital content, and managing social media accounts. You may attend meetings, shadow professionals in different departments, and assist with administrative tasks to help keep operations running smoothly. The dynamic nature of the media industry means that daily tasks can change rapidly, offering valuable exposure to different areas such as news, entertainment, sports, or digital content. This hands-on experience will enhance your industry knowledge and can lead to networking opportunities and potential full-time roles after your internship.

Does NBC offer internships?

NBC offers internships across various departments, including journalism, production, and digital media. These internships typically provide hands-on experience and may require applicants to be enrolled in a related academic program or have relevant skills. Interested candidates should check NBC's official careers page for current opportunities and application details.

What skills and qualifications are needed for an NBC internship?

To thrive as an NBC Intern, you'll need a foundational understanding of media production, communication, and journalism, often demonstrated by relevant coursework or previous internship experience. Familiarity with tools such as Adobe Creative Suite, newsroom software, digital editing platforms, or social media analytics is highly valued. Stand-out candidates possess strong organizational skills, adaptability, teamwork, and a proactive attitude in fast-paced environments. These skills allow interns to contribute effectively, learn quickly, and take advantage of growth opportunities within the media industry.

Job Description

  • Select, assign, write, and organize news stories. Write headlines, teases, and reporter lead-ins
  • Write new scripts, promotional teasers, headlines and topicals.
  • Contribute story ideas, participate in daily coverage decisions and editorial meetings.
  • Assist in the overall production, content, and elements of each newscast
  • Collaborate with news producers, managers and photographers across the group to conceptualize, write, edit, and produce Telemundo news specials and packages based on either breaking or pre-planned stories
  • Communicate with news producers, assignment editors and managers across the division regarding local story development, progress in the field and/or breaking news stories

Desired Characteristics:

  • Students with class standing of junior or above preferred.
  • Cumulative GPA of 3.0 or above.
  • Attention to detail and strong organizational skills
  • Excellent computer skills (specially search skills)

The hourly rate for undergraduate student interns is $17.00 per hour

Qualifications
  • In pursuit of an Associate, Bachelor or Graduate degree at an Accredited Institution and be able to provide documentation to confirm your degree progress
  • Current class standing of sophomore or above (30 credits)
  • Must be available to work at least 30 hours per week
  • Must be bilingual in Spanish (written and verbal fluently).  
  • Must be 18 years of age or older
  • Must be authorized to work in the United States without visa sponsorship by NBCUniversal
  • Need to be able to work on-site in Las Vegas, NV.

Desired Qualifications

  • Previous internship experience or on-campus involvement
  • Ability to work effectively in a high-intensity environment, often under tight deadline pressures
  • Strong written and oral communication skills
  • Attention to detail and strong organizational skills
  • Strong interest in and demonstrated knowledge of current affairs
  • Excellent computer skills (especially search skills)
